摘要: iOS的整体架构分为4层——Cocoa Touch层、Media层、Core Services层和Core OS层,下面概要介绍一下这4层。Cocoa Touch:构建iOS应用的一些基本系统服务,如多任务,触摸输入和推送通知Address Book UI : 前缀为AB,访问用户的联系人信息E... 阅读全文
posted @ 2015-11-12 17:02 Tonge 阅读(1170) 评论(0) 推荐(0) 编辑
摘要: iOS应用的视图状态分为以下几种在viewcontroller的父类UIViewController中可以看到如下代码,通过重写不同的方法对操作视图渲染。@available(iOS 2.0, *)public class UIViewController{ public func viewD... 阅读全文
posted @ 2015-11-12 16:14 Tonge 阅读(929) 评论(0) 推荐(0) 编辑
摘要: iOS应用通过委托对象AppDelegate类在应用周期的不同阶段会回调不同的方法,应用周期分为以下五种状态: Not Running(非运行状态)。应用没有运行或被系统终止。  Inactive(前台非活动状态)。应用正在进入前台状态,但是还不能接受事件处理。 Active(前台活动状态)。... 阅读全文
posted @ 2015-11-12 14:49 Tonge 阅读(759) 评论(1) 推荐(0) 编辑